Transaction 89ce51e3210cee5b4e9ebf131696ab5aaeddd62875bbfea1a6d1e147a04c379c
1 Input
2 Outputs
- 89ce51e3210cee5b4e9ebf131696ab5aaeddd62875bbfea1a6d1e147a04c379c:0
- 89ce51e3210cee5b4e9ebf131696ab5aaeddd62875bbfea1a6d1e147a04c379c:1
value 42765272
address 12LgMGfWVrH3V7HrH88R6eVGiFGNDgACym
value 29683199
address 1PH7FT8ENA5BufHVjekQhLSSs5HfbWrx2A